Mosaic

出自Local Chinese Wikipedia
跳至導覽 跳至搜尋

Template:NoteTA

Template:Otheruses

Template:Infobox Software

NCSA Mosaic,是一款已停止開發的網頁瀏覽器,在1990年代對於全球資訊網普及具有關鍵性的作用[1][2][3]。儘管Mosaic並非史上第一款網頁瀏覽器,在其更早的之前已有WorldWideWebErwise[4]ViolaWWW,但Mosaic是第一個能夠在文字中直接顯示圖片,而不是在單獨視窗中顯示圖片的瀏覽器[5]。Mosaic支援多種互聯網協定如HTTPFTPNNTPGopher[6]。其直覺的介面、對個人電腦的支援以及簡易的安裝過程,皆促成了Mosaic的普及[7]

Mosaic由伊利諾大學厄巴納香檳分校國家超級電腦應用中心於1992年底開發[5],並於1993年1月發佈[8],官方開發與支援一直持續到1997年1月[9]。Mosaic的市佔率在1994年底輸給了Netscape Navigator[10],到了1997年專案終止時,僅剩極少數的使用者。1995年,微軟獲得了其衍生商業產品Spyglass Mosaic的授權,並以此開發出Internet Explorer[11]

歷史[編輯]

File:Mosaic 1.0 for Mac.png
執行於System 7.1環境下的Mosaic 1.0。圖中顯示的網頁為Mosaic通訊公司的官方網站。

1991年,腳本錯誤:沒有「ilh」這個模塊。獲得通過,為NCSA的新計劃提供了資金。David Thompson向NCSA的軟件設計小組展示了ViolaWWW瀏覽器[12]。這啟發了當時在NCSA工作的兩位程式設計師馬克·安德森埃里克·比納着手開發Mosaic。安德森與比納於1991年2月開始針對UNIX的X Window系統開發Mosaic,並將其命名為xmosaic[5][12][13]。1.0正式版於1993年4月21日發佈[14]。隨後在同年9月,支援Microsoft Windows與Macintosh的版本也相繼問世[12]。到了1993年10月,Amiga版本的Mosaic也已開發完成。1993年11月10日,適用於X Window系統的NCSA Mosaic 2.0版正式發佈[15],其重要意義在於新增了對網頁表單的支援,進而促成了首批動態網頁的誕生。從1994年至1997年,國家科學基金會持續資助Mosaic的後續開發工作[16]

Mosaic開發團隊的領導人馬克·安德森離開了NCSA,並與SGI公司的創始人之一吉姆·克拉克,以及其他四位前伊利諾大學的學生與職員共同創立了Mosaic Communication Corporation[17],Mosaic Communications最終更名為Netscape Communications Corporation,並推出了Netscape Navigator瀏覽器。隨着1994年Netscape Navigator的問世,Mosaic瀏覽器的普及度開始下滑。在《The HTML Sourcebook: The Complete Guide to HTML》中曾提到其重要性:「Netscape通訊公司設計了一個全新的全球資訊網瀏覽器Netscape,比原來的Mosaic程式有明顯的改進。」[18]

影響[編輯]

Mosaic引發了1990年代互聯網熱潮,雖然同一時期存在其他瀏覽器,像是ErwiseViolaWWWMidasWWW腳本錯誤:沒有「ilh」這個模塊。,但這些瀏覽器促使公眾使用互聯網的影響力遠不及Mosaic[19]

Mosaic並非第一款適用於Windows的網頁瀏覽器,而是鮮為人知的Cello[20]。Mosaic的Unix版本在Windows版本推出之前已經聞名於世,除了可以在文字中嵌入圖片,而不是在單獨的視窗之外,Mosaic的功能與ViolaWWW相似[5],不過Mosaic是第一款由全職程式設計師團隊編寫與支援的瀏覽器,對於初學者來說相當可靠和易於安裝,而內嵌圖片被證明具有極大的吸引力,Mosaic讓互聯網對於一般大眾來說變得觸手可及。

頁面Template:Quote/blockquote.css沒有內容。

Mosaic是廣受讚譽的圖形化瀏覽器,允許使用者透過點選介面在電子訊息世界中暢遊。Mosaic那迷人的外觀鼓勵著使用者將自己的文件上傳到網絡,包括彩色圖片、聲音片段、影片剪輯以及連向其他文件的超文字連結。隨着點選—連結,這個連結上的文件就能夠顯示出來—你可以通過這種突發奇想而又直覺的方式在網絡世界中穿梭。Mosaic不是發現訊息的最直接方式,也不是最強大的,不過是最讓人愉悅的方式,而在發佈後的18個月裏,Mosaic已經引發了網絡歷史上前所未有的興奮和商業活力[21]

1992年11月,世界上只有僅僅26個網站,每一個網站都受人注目[22]。在Mosaic發佈的1993年,推出了一個叫做What’s New的頁面,每天大約會增加一個新連結[23]。當時,互聯網的發展正迅速從學術界和大型工業研究機構擴散至其他領域。這正是Mosaic瀏覽器的普及,推動了互聯網的爆炸式成長,網站數量在1995年8月突破一萬個,並在1998年達到數百萬個[24]。Metcalfe曾如此形容Mosaic的關鍵地位:

頁面Template:Quote/blockquote.css沒有內容。

在Web的第一代,添·柏納斯-李使用基於Unix的伺服器和瀏覽器原型,建立了統一資源定位符(URL),超文字傳輸協定(HTTP)和HTML標準。一些人意識到Web可能比Gopher更好。

在第二代,馬克·安德森和埃里克·比納在伊利諾大學開發了NCSA Mosaic瀏覽器。幾百萬人突然發現Web可能比性愛更令人着迷。

在第三代,安德森和比納離開NCSA,創立了Netscape...

授權[編輯]

NCSA Mosaic的授權條款對於商業軟件而言相對寬鬆。一般而言,所有版本的非商業用途皆為免費,但有部分限制。此外,X Window版本公開提供了原始碼,而其他版本的原始碼則需在簽署協議後方可取得。截至1993年,授權持有者包括Amdahl Corporation、富士通、Infoseek、Quarterdeck、聖克魯茲作業、SPRY以及Spyglass[27]

Spyglass公司向NCSA取得技術與商標授權,用於開發自家的網頁瀏覽器,但從未實際使用任何NCSA Mosaic的原始碼[28]。1995年,微軟以200萬美元的價格向Spyglass取得授權,進行修改後將其重新命名為Internet Explorer[29]。在後來的授權爭議後,微軟又向Spyglass支付了800萬美元[30]。1995年出版的《The HTML Sourcebook: The Complete Guide to HTML》在名為Coming Attractions的章節中明確指出,Internet Explorer「將以Mosaic程式為基礎」[18]Template:R/superscript

在NCSA停止Mosaic開發之後,X Window系統的NCSA Mosaic原始碼由幾個獨立的小組繼續進行開發。這些獨立的開發工作包括2004年初停止開發的mMosaic(multicast Mosaic)[31]、Mosaic-CK和VMS Mosaic。

參考文獻[編輯]

外部連結[編輯]

參見[編輯]

Template:網頁瀏覽器時間線 Template:Web browser